KINGMAN – An early Thursday fire destroyed an unoccupied, two story residence in downtown Kingman. Public Information Officer Oscar Lopez said Kingman Fire Department personnel responded at 1:11 a.m. to the incident in the 600 block of South Fourth Street.
“First arriving fire personnel found heavy fire and smoke exiting the structure,” Lopez said. “Crews were able to conduct a primary all clear on the first floor, but were forced to evacuate as the structure was deemed unsafe.”
Lopez said utility workers handled some electric lines that were inhibiting firefighting operations. The blaze was brought under control in about an hour.
Lopez said there were no injuries, the home was a total loss and that the cause of the fire remains under investigation.
